Output 6caa3497f50b47c366dc23e49f07f5fb4b24ad3f48f227cf8de217cdbef5f2cb:6

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8f3ac86a2f0bbd06bd4b4f1199c7d54c7c9bb6 OP_EQUAL
address
3QXrSGc5EDSWudi3aRHc1Lve5d9PrLk6tm
transaction
6caa3497f50b47c366dc23e49f07f5fb4b24ad3f48f227cf8de217cdbef5f2cb
confirmations
346812
spent
true